摘要
Two novel exopolysaccharicle-producing bacteria, strains S18K6(T) and S18K5, were isolated from Pacific Ocean sediment. The isolates were Gram-negative, motile, strictly aerobic chemoheterotrophic bacteria. The DNA G+C contents of strains S18K6(T) and S18K5 were 44(.)8 and 46.3 mol%, respectively. DNA-DNA relatedness between the two strains was 70%. Major fatty acids were hexadecanoic acid (C-16:0), hexadecenoic acid (C-16:1 omega 7c) and octadecenoic acid (C-18:1 omega 7c). 16S rRNA gene sequence, chemotaxonomic and morphological data indicated that these strains clearly belonged to the genus Glaciecola. Based on phenotypic properties and DNA-DNA hybridization data, strains S18K6(T) and S18K5 are considered to represent a novel species of the genus Glaciecola, for which the name Glaciecola chathamensis so. nov. is proposed. The type strain is S18K6(T) (=JCM 13645(T)= NCIMB 14146(T)).
